  • Chris Jericho
    May 22 2025

    On this week's episode of The Eddie Trunk Podcast - From his KISS tribute band Kuarantine's success with 'Turn on the Night' to Fozzy's latest single, Chris Jericho opens up about balancing wrestling and music. He shares hilarious stories about early WASP interviews, the evolution of stage names, and his deep connection to 80s KISS. The conversation weaves through Billy Squier samples, wrestling personas, and the challenges of maintaining dual careers in entertainment.

  • Paul Rodgers & Rikki Rockett
    May 15 2025

    On this week's episode of The Eddie Trunk Podcast - Eddie brings you his recent conversation with Paul Rodgers who shares his journey from forming Bad Company to their upcoming Rock and Roll Hall of Fame induction. He reveals fascinating stories about recording their debut album at a haunted mansion, working with Led Zeppelin's Peter Grant, and the origins of classics like 'Rock and Roll Fantasy' and 'Shooting Star.' Rodgers also discusses his remarkable recovery from three strokes and his return to music with the 'Midnight Rose' album. Also in this week's podcast, a chat with Rikki Rockett who opens up about Poison's potential 40th anniversary headlining tour in 2026. He shares exciting news about his band The Rockett Mafia's upcoming charity show, their unique approach to covering classic songs, and his forthcoming memoir 'Ghost Notes.'

  • Don Felder & Wendy Dio
    May 8 2025

    On this week's episode of The Eddie Trunk Podcast - Eddie shares his interview with rock legend Don Felder who shared the story behind his new album 'The Vault,' born from discovering decades of forgotten recordings in storage. He revealed how his slide guitar changed the Eagles' sound, the surprising origin of 'Hotel California,' and his journey from writing music beds for the band to creating his own path. With remarkable candor, Felder reflects on making peace with his Eagles past while embracing his creative freedom today. After that, Eddie brings you his conversation with Wendy Dio who discussed the upcoming Rock for Ronnie cancer benefit concert (on May 18th) and the Dio Cancer Fund's groundbreaking research.
